igital photo-manipulation is a closer kin to painting than photography. The artist's time is most at stake as she molds the image, pixel by pixel. Layering textures and juxtaposing images to achieve a unified statement, a deliberate, symbolic vision that allows us to see the commonplace anew, fine-tuning to single-degrees of subliminal transparency in the hope of reaching the sublime.

This set of images was featured on the giant LCD screen overlooking West Hollywood's Sunset strip.
